掌握Arch Linux下VMware虚拟化技术全攻略

arch vmware

时间:2025-03-20 07:43


探索Arch Linux与VMware的强强联合:构建高效虚拟化环境 在当今的数字化时代,虚拟化技术已成为企业和个人用户不可或缺的重要工具

    它不仅提供了资源的高效利用,还增强了系统的灵活性和可扩展性

    而在众多虚拟化解决方案中,VMware凭借其强大的功能和广泛的应用场景,成为了虚拟化领域的佼佼者

    然而,要让VMware发挥出最大的效能,选择一个合适的操作系统作为宿主环境同样至关重要

    Arch Linux,以其轻量级、高性能和高度可定制化的特点,成为了与VMware强强联合的理想选择

     一、Arch Linux:性能与自由的完美结合 Arch Linux,一个以简洁、高效和滚动更新为特点的Linux发行版,自诞生以来就受到了广大技术爱好者的青睐

    它提供了一个极小的基础系统,用户可以根据自己的需求自由选择和安装所需的软件包和服务

    这种高度可定制化的特性,使得Arch Linux能够在各种硬件和虚拟化环境中表现出色

     1. 轻量级内核与高效资源管理 Arch Linux采用了一个轻量级且经过精心优化的Linux内核,这使得它在虚拟化环境中能够更有效地利用资源

    无论是CPU、内存还是磁盘I/O,Arch Linux都能提供出色的性能表现

    这对于需要在虚拟化环境中运行多个虚拟机或进行高负载任务的用户来说,无疑是一个巨大的优势

     2. 滚动更新与最新技术 Arch Linux采用滚动更新的方式,即每次更新都会将系统升级到最新的软件包版本

    这意味着用户可以始终享受到最新的技术特性和安全修复,而无需担心版本过时而带来的兼容性问题

    在虚拟化环境中,这种持续的技术更新对于确保系统的稳定性和安全性至关重要

     3. 高度可定制化与灵活性 Arch Linux提供了丰富的软件包管理工具,如pacman和AUR(Arch User Repository),用户可以根据自己的需求轻松安装和配置所需的软件包和服务

    这种高度可定制化的特性使得Arch Linux能够轻松适应各种虚拟化场景,无论是作为开发环境、测试平台还是生产环境,都能提供出色的表现

     二、VMware:虚拟化领域的领航者 VMware作为全球领先的虚拟化解决方案提供商,其产品涵盖了服务器虚拟化、桌面虚拟化、云基础设施和移动虚拟化等多个领域

    VMware虚拟化技术以其高效、可靠和易于管理的特点,广泛应用于各种企业和个人用户场景中

     1. 高效资源利用与隔离 VMware虚拟化技术通过抽象化硬件资源,实现了虚拟机之间的高效资源利用和隔离

    这使得用户可以在同一物理机上运行多个虚拟机,而无需担心资源冲突或性能瓶颈

    这种资源的高效利用不仅降低了硬件成本,还提高了系统的灵活性和可扩展性

     2. 强大的管理工具与自动化 VMware提供了一系列强大的管理工具,如vSphere、vCenter Server等,这些工具使得用户能够轻松管理、监控和优化虚拟化环境

    此外,VMware还支持自动化部署和配置,大大简化了虚拟机的创建和管理过程

    这些特性对于需要管理大量虚拟机或复杂虚拟化环境的用户来说,无疑是一个巨大的福音

     3. 广泛的兼容性与安全性 VMware虚拟化技术具有广泛的兼容性,能够支持各种操作系统、应用程序和硬件平台

    这意味着用户可以在虚拟化环境中轻松运行各种工作负载,而无需担心兼容性问题

    同时,VMware还提供了强大的安全性功能,如虚拟化安全加固、网络隔离和漏洞扫描等,确保虚拟化环境的安全可靠

     三、Arch Linux与VMware的强强联合 将Arch Linux与VMware相结合,可以充分发挥两者的优势,构建出一个高效、可靠且易于管理的虚拟化环境

    以下是一些具体的优势和应用场景: 1. 高性能虚拟化环境 Arch Linux的轻量级内核和高效资源管理特性,使得它在VMware虚拟化环境中能够表现出色

    无论是运行大型数据库、进行复杂计算任务还是进行实时数据分析,Arch Linux都能提供出色的性能表现

    这种高性能虚拟化环境对于需要处理大量数据或进行高负载任务的用户来说,无疑是一个理想的选择

     2. 高度可定制化的开发环境 Arch Linux的高度可定制化特性使得它能够轻松适应各种开发需求

    通过安装所需的编程语言和开发工具,用户可以快速搭建起一个适合自己的开发环境

    而VMware虚拟化技术则提供了资源隔离和高效利用的优势,使得开发人员可以在不影响其他虚拟机的情况下进行开发工作

    这种高度可定制化的开发环境对于提高开发效率和降低开发成本具有重要意义

     3. 高效测试与部署平台 在软件开发过程中,测试是一个至关重要的环节

    通过将Arch Linux与VMware相结合,用户可以轻松搭建起一个高效的测试平台

    在这个平台上,用户可以模拟各种场景和条件,对软件进行全面的测试

    同时,VMware虚拟化技术还支持自动化部署和配置,使得测试过程更加高效和便捷

    这种高效测试与部署平台对于提高软件质量和缩短开发周期具有重要意义

     4. 灵活的云基础设施 随着云计算技术的不断发展,越来越多的企业和个人用户开始将业务迁移到云端

    通过将Arch Linux与VMware相结合,用户可以轻松搭建起一个灵活的云基础设施

    在这个基础设施上,用户可以部署各种云服务、存储和计算资源,以满足不同的业务需求

    同时,VMware虚拟化技术还支持多租户管理和资源优化,使得云基础设施更加高效和可靠

     四、结论 综上所述,Arch Linux与VMware的强强联合为构建高效虚拟化环境提供了有力的支持

    通过充分发挥两者的优势,用户可以轻松搭建起一个高性能、高度可定制化和易于管理的虚拟化环境

    这种虚拟化环境不仅提高了系统的灵活性和可扩展性,还降低了硬件成本和维护成本

    因此,对于需要在虚拟化环境中运行各种工作负载的用户来说,Arch Linux与VMware的结合无疑是一个值得推荐的选择

     在未来的发展中,随着虚拟化技术的不断进步和应用场景的不断拓展,Arch Linux与VMware的结合将会发挥出更大的潜力

    无论是对于企业用户还是个人用户来说,这种结合都将为他们带来更加高效、可靠和便捷的虚拟化体验

    因此,我们有理由相信,Arch Linux与VMware的强强联合将会成为未来虚拟化领域的重要趋势之一